LBRG Engineering Lab
The Engineering Lab applies simulation models discretized with Lattice Boltzmann Method (LBM) to realistic engineering problems using OpenLB software library. The Lab is focused on turbulent reactive Multiscale Multiphase Multicomponent flows to enable design and optimization of modern complex chemical apparats. The next working direction of the Lab is the turbulent fluid-structure interaction problems e.g. wind turbines, airplanes, and centrifugal pumps.
